Q: Is 26,576,520 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 26,576,520 is a composite number.

Why is 26,576,520 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 26,576,520 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 8 10 12 15 20 24 30 40 60 120 221,471 442,942 664,413 885,884 1,107,355 1,328,826 1,771,768 2,214,710 2,657,652 3,322,065 4,429,420 5,315,304 6,644,130 8,858,840 13,288,260 and 26,576,520, with no remainder.

Since 26,576,520 cannot be divided by just 1 and 26,576,520, it is a composite number.
